Cycles: Render Passes

Currently supported passes:
* Combined, Z, Normal, Object Index, Material Index, Emission, Environment,
  Diffuse/Glossy/Transmission x Direct/Indirect/Color

Not supported yet:
* UV, Vector, Mist

Only enabled for CPU devices at the moment, will do GPU tweaks tommorrow,
also for environment importance sampling.
